  6. COMMUNICATION PLAN Submit all inquiries through the SPP Request Management System (RMS) using the WEIS Market Quick Pick and Subtype 1 of Market Trials. For errors or unexpected results that occur during test execution, which require SPP troubleshooting or intervention, MPs should provide error steps and details through RMS using the WEIS Market Quick Pick and Subtype 1 of Market Trials. For mass or immediate communications that need to be sent from SPP to Market Participants, outreach will be via e-mail to WEIS Market Testing Liaisons. All other SPP communications to specific Market Participants will be sent to WEIS Market Testing Liaisons via RMS. SPP will publish Market Trials materials to the WEIS Market Trials folderon SPP.org. 6

  9. TEST CHECKLISTS The MTE Test Checklist consists of multiple tabs for different areas of testing. The potential areas of testing consist of: Portal, Markets, Settlements, Tags and XML Notification Listener. Each tab consists of both UI and API test cases. MPs not using APIs can skip these tests. It is strongly recommended that users who plan to access the SPP systems via API only, also test UI access as a backup method. 9

CONNECTIVITY TEST EXIT CRITERIA All Market Participants are required to participate Each MP will have completed the Connectivity Checklist and returned it to SPP indicating success SPP will request an attestation statement from each MP to move to the next stage of Market Trials The status of each MP s readiness to move between each stage of market trials will be reported to the program leadership, including the WMEC. 11

WEIS WRTBM BASE CASE GUIDE The purpose of the WEIS WRTBM Base Case document is to guide Market Participants (MPs) of the Western Energy Imbalance Services (WEIS) Market through testing of the Western Real- Time Balancing Market (WRTBM) base case scenario which includes typical market and settlement functionality. This document also describes SPP and MP roles and responsibilities necessary to complete this test scenario. The document can be found in the Market Trials Folder on spp.org here. 13
